Keystone Job Corps Center has 11 dormitories, and each houses from
34 to 88 students. There are many fun activities to take part in
on center, such as billiards, dances, arts and crafts and weightlifting,
as well as sports, including basketball, softball, soccer, flag
football and volleyball.
Students can also take advantage of leadership opportunities through
the Student Government Association, WICS Council, Rotoract and community
service projects.
Keystone Job Corps Center partners with several employers to give
students real-world experience. Employer partners include Federal
Army Depot, hospitals and medical centers, HCR Manor Care, Lowe's
and Manpower
